Fidau Prayer Scheduled for Late Chief Imam of Ilorin
The Ilorin Emirate Council has announced the schedule for the Fidāu prayer in honour of the late Chief Imam of Ilorin, Sheikh (Dr.) Muhammad Bashir Imam Saliu Al-Fulani, OON.
According to the announcement, the Fidāu prayer will be held on Sunday, 25th January 2026, at 10:00 a.m., at the Ilorin Central Mosque, Emir’s Palace Square, Ilorin.
The late Chief Imam, a highly respected Islamic scholar and spiritual leader, was renowned for his lifelong dedication to Islam, scholarship, and community service. His passing has been deeply felt across the Ilorin Emirate, Kwara State, and the wider Nigerian Muslim community.
The Emirate Council called on members of the public, Islamic scholars, and well-wishers to attend the prayer session and join in supplications for the repose of his soul.
The Council prayed Allah (SWT) to forgive the shortcomings of the late cleric and grant him Al-Jannatul Firdaus.
The announcement was issued by Dr. Abdulraheem Muritala, on behalf of the Emir of Ilorin.
